How to Solve Bubble Word Jam Level 189 — Full Solution
- Start with the insect bubble `BEETLE / BEE / ANT`.
- Clear the `DAIRY / MEAT / BAKERY` side while the chain is still holding the center.
- Use the room to settle the fashion-and-scent words `TIE / SCARF / NECKLACE / COLLAR / PERFUME / COLOGNE / AROMA / ESSENCE`.
- Keep the mushroom lane `MOREL / CHANTERELLE / PORTOBELLO / SHIITAKE` away from the late vegetable and media cleanup `POTATO / CARROT / OKRA / FENNEL` and `CHRONICLE / COMPENDIUM / CODEX / ENCYCLOPEDIA`.
- Finish with the compact console and venom leftovers around `SONY / NINTENDO / DISC` and `VENOM / FANGS / ARACHNID / WEB`.
